Upgrading E1000 to VMXNET3

Hello,
Could someone please help my upgrade my VMware Network card?
Currently we are running the e1000 and I would like t move to vmxnet3

every time I shut down a machine and attempt to change the card type is greyed out.  it wants me to add a new network card!  im thinking / hoping that there has to be a better / Faster Way to do this!

Could someone please assist?

If you want to retain your MAC to be same as the previous one ,,, make a note of it ,,

and u can edit the mac to be static in vmx file as well or by the edit setting of network adapter property .. and use manual entry

ANd to change the adapter ,, you need to remove and add a new one and configure it
